description American Optical General Overview
The American Optical General sunglasses represent a classic design originating from its use by U.S. military pilots during World War II. These metal-framed aviator styles are recognized for their robust build and iconic brow bar feature. They remain popular among individuals seeking a timeless aesthetic and durable eyewear, particularly those appreciating vintage aviation influences.

Are American Optical General sunglasses the same as the original military aviators?
Yes, the American Optical (AO) General sunglasses were initially designed for U.S. military aviators in the 1940s. They feature the exact same durable construction and distinctive brow line that was issued to pilots during World War II.
What type of lenses do American Optical General sunglasses use?
The General sunglasses typically feature premium, scratch-resistant glass lenses, such as the famous AO True Color gray or the AGX green. These high-quality lenses provide 100% UV protection while maintaining true optical clarity.
Do the AO General sunglasses have straight or curved temples?
They feature the classic, straight "bayonet" temples originally designed to fit comfortably under a fighter pilot's helmet. This straight design allows them to easily slip on and off without messing up the wearer's hair.
Where are American Optical sunglasses manufactured?
American Optical takes pride in the fact that their General sunglasses are still manufactured in the United States. The frames and glass lenses are carefully assembled in their Illinois factory, ensuring authentic military-spec quality.
